Frozen Locks
Winter brings cold temperatures and ice however it also creates problems for our cars. A frozen lock is a common issue that can be a real pain, especially if you're trying to start your car or go back inside after work. Fortunately, there are many ways to solve this problem.
One of the most well-known solutions to this problem is to make use of a lock de-icer. The chemical contained within the bottle melts the ice in the lock making it easier to open the door and insert the key. You can also heat the metal part of your key by using matches or lighters. However, it's important to be cautious when doing this. If you're not cautious, you could end up damaging the lock's cylinder or yourself.
Keep your locks clean to avoid freezing. Dust can build up in the keyhole, making it difficult to insert keys into the cylinder. You can spray lubricating products into the lock, which helps to break up the ice that has formed. WD-40 is a great choice because it can dissolve the ice quickly and easily.
